Select a microwave-safe bowl and add ½ cup of kernels into it. Cover the bowl with a plate which should also be microwavable. Now put this bowl in the microwave and heat it for 2-5 minutes. Timings can vary according to the microwave’s wattage and the number of ...

Place the heavy pan on the stove and pour 2 tablespoons (30 ml) of canola or vegetable oil into it. Put 2 of the popcorn kernels into the pan and put the lid on. If you use a pan with a glass lid, you'll be able to see when the kernels pop. WebNov 5, 2024 · Start with a clean, dry paper bag.
